Automated screening and screening parameters

Automated screening in trade compliance software tools involves the use of advanced algorithms to systematically evaluate shipments, entities, and transactions against established trade regulations. This process helps identify potential risks or violations early, streamlining compliance efforts.

Screening parameters are customizable criteria set by organizations to tailor the screening process to specific trade activities. These parameters may include country of origin, destination, product classification, parties involved, and documented licenses.

Trade compliance software tools utilize these screening parameters to automatically flag suspicious transactions or entities for further review. This proactive approach reduces manual oversight, minimizes errors, and enhances the overall efficiency of compliance procedures.

Key benefits of automated screening with screening parameters include faster decision-making, consistent application of compliance rules, and improved accuracy in detecting potential regulatory breaches, thereby helping companies adhere to trade compliance laws more effectively.

Export and import license tracking

Export and import license tracking refers to the capability of trade compliance software tools to monitor and manage licenses necessary for international trade operations. This feature ensures businesses stay compliant with regulatory requirements and avoid penalties. Accurate license management is vital for legal trade execution and supply chain integrity.

Trade compliance software tools facilitate real-time tracking of license statuses, renewal dates, and expiry periods. They automate alerts for renewal deadlines, preventing unintentional violations due to lapsed licensing. This automation reduces administrative burdens and minimizes compliance risks.

Additionally, these tools enable centralized documentation of all licenses, supporting audit preparedness and easier record retrieval. They often integrate with customs and government databases to verify license validity instantly, providing assurance that shipments adhere to applicable trade regulations. This capability enhances overall operational efficiency and regulatory adherence.

Effective license tracking also helps businesses navigate complex licensing jurisdictions by providing clear visibility of license requirements across multiple regions. Such features support compliance with export controls and import restrictions, fulfilling legal obligations under trade compliance law.

Common Pitfalls and Best Practices in Utilizing Trade Compliance Software Tools

In utilizing trade compliance software tools effectively, organizations often encounter pitfalls arising from inconsistent data entry and inadequate user training. These issues can lead to inaccuracies in screening parameters and delays in compliance processes. Regular staff training and clear operational guidelines are essential best practices to mitigate these risks.

Another common challenge is overreliance on automation without human oversight. While automation enhances efficiency, it may produce errors if the software’s rules are not regularly reviewed or updated. Incorporating periodic manual audits and validations helps ensure compliance accuracy and reduces the likelihood of costly mistakes.

Integrating trade compliance tools with other enterprise systems is also frequently overlooked. Poor integration can result in incomplete data flow and non-compliance with reporting obligations. Establishing seamless connections and maintaining data consistency across platforms is a best practice to maximize software effectiveness and ensure compliance adherence.

Lastly, ignoring ongoing regulatory updates can undermine the benefits of trade compliance software tools. Implementing robust update protocols and staying informed about changes in trade laws help maintain the system’s relevance and reliability. Adhering to these best practices ensures that trade compliance software tools fulfill their potential in supporting lawful and efficient trade operations.
